Summary
In this episode, Seth Pepper shares his journey from a late starter in swimming to becoming a national champion, emphasizing the importance of effort over results. He discusses the significance of mindset, the role of parents in supporting young athletes, and how to navigate pressure and expectations in sports and life. The conversation highlights practical strategies for parents to foster a healthy relationship with their children in sports, focusing on effort, curiosity, and personal growth rather than solely on outcomes.
